MYRTLE BEACH, S.C. (WMBF) - The SpaceX Falcon 9 rocket launch will likely be visible Tuesday morning from the Grand Strand. The launch is set for 5:36 AM from Cape Canaveral, Florida. ROCKET LAUNCH | Upload your pictures and videos here The four-hour launch window opens up at 5:20 AM and is expected to launch at 5:36 AM Tuesday. A SpaceX Falcon 9 rocket will launch a batch of Starlink V2 Mini satellites to low Earth orbit.

MYRTLE BEACH, SC (WMBF) - Ernesto is the third hurricane of the season so far and is forecast to become a major hurricane by the end of the week. At 11 am, the center of Hurricane Ernesto was located near latitude 25.0 North, longitude 69.2 West. Ernesto is moving toward the north near 14 mph (22 km/h). This general motion is expected to continue today, followed by a slower northeastward or north-northeastward motion on Friday and Saturday.
